Persons who died during the year ending May 31, 1880, enumerated by me in Rico, in the County of Ouray, Colorado. E.A. Robinson, Enumerator |
|||||||||||||
| 90* | Kaufman, Chas. | 45 | M | W | M | Wurtenberg | Wurtenbg. | Wurtenbg. | Butcher | May | Pneumonia | 9/12 | |
| 126 | North, Louisa | 52 | F | W | M | New York | NY | NY | Kept House | Nov | Pneumonia | 2/12 | |
|
81** |
Walihen, Stephen |
42 | M | W | S | New York | NY | NY | Miner | May | Pneumonia | 1 | |
| *** | Burgen, (Burgess?) Julius | 45 | M | W | Unknown | Unknown | Unknown | Ranchman | Aug | Shot | 5 hours | ||
| **** | Morrow, W.G. | 28 | M | W | Unknown | Unknown | Unknown | Saloon Kpr. | Sept. | Shot | 3/12 | ||
| North, Mrs. Lucy | F | W | M | Housewife | Oct | Pneumonia | |||||||
| Herod, Thomas | 38 | M | W | M? | Miner | Sept | Brights Dis | ||||||
| Morrison, A. | 32 | F | W | M | Farmer | Aug | Peritonitis | ||||||
|
* & ** The primary cause of deaths reported on lines 1 & 3 was the excessive use of whiskey ***The death shot reported on line 4 was received in a drunken row and one Geo. M. Goldrick is now in jail awaiting trial for killing Burgen ****The death reported on line 5 was an accident, such being the verdict of the jury at inquest. |
